Step-by-Step: Quick Vape Tank Cleaning (Warm Water Method)

 Cleaning Guide

 

If you’re sticking to the same flavor or just need a fast refresh, this method works great.

Step 1: Disassemble Your Tank

Detach the tank from the mod. Take it apart fully—separate the glass, base, top cap, coil (if reusable), and drip tip.

Tip: Make sure your hands are clean to prevent oil transfer to the tank.

Step 2: Rinse Under Warm Water

Run each part (except the coil) under warm water for 30 seconds to 1 minute. This helps remove residual juice.

Step 3: Optional – Use Dish Soap

If you have stubborn residue, mix a drop of mild dish soap with water. Clean gently using your fingers or a soft brush.

Step 4: Dry Thoroughly

Use a microfiber cloth or paper towel to dry each component. Let them air dry for 10-15 minutes to ensure no moisture remains.

Step-by-Step: Deep Clean Vape Tank (For Better Flavor)

cleaning vape

When switching e-liquids or tackling lingering flavors, a deep clean is your best bet.

Step 1: Disassemble the Tank

Again, remove every piece of the tank and set aside the coil—do not wash the coil if it’s a stock, prebuilt one.

Reminder: Only rebuildable coils can be cleaned and reused. Most factory coils will be damaged by water or alcohol.

Step 2: Soak in Vodka or Alcohol

Place the tank parts (excluding coil) in a bowl of unflavored vodka or isopropyl alcohol for 30–60 minutes. This dissolves sticky residue and removes ghost flavors.

Step 3: Scrub if Needed

Use a cotton swab or soft toothbrush to gently scrub inside the tank’s threads and crevices.

Step 4: Rinse with Warm Water

Thoroughly rinse every component under warm water to remove alcohol residue.

Step 5: Dry Completely

Pat everything dry and let sit on a paper towel until fully dry—preferably overnight.

How to Clean Vape Coils (And What NOT to Do)

Step-by-Step: Deep Clean Vape Tank (For Better Flavor)

One of the most common questions is: Can I wash my vape coil?

Stock Coils (Prebuilt)

  • Do not wash prebuilt stock coils with water or alcohol.
  • They contain cotton that gets damaged by moisture.
  • If your coil tastes burnt or produces poor vapor, replace it.

Rebuildable Coils (RDA/RTA)

  • Can be cleaned by dry-burning and brushing.
  • Rinse under warm water after dry-burn and let them dry completely before reuse.

Pro Tip: If unsure whether your coil is rebuildable, assume it’s not and don’t risk washing it.

What Are Ghost Flavors?

Ghost flavors are the leftover traces of previously used e-liquids that remain in your vape tank, coil, or even mouthpiece, even after you’ve emptied the tank. These remnants can mix with your new flavor, creating an unpleasant or muddled taste.

 Why Do Ghost Flavors Happen?

cleaning vape

Several parts of your vape setup can absorb and trap old flavors:

  • Wick inside the coil: Especially cotton wicks in stock coils absorb previous e-liquids deeply.
  • Tank walls and base: Sticky, sweet e-liquids can coat the tank interior with residue.
  • Drip tip (mouthpiece): Often overlooked, this can carry leftover flavors.
  • Rubber O-rings: These tiny seals can absorb strong or sweet flavors over time.

Ghosting is most noticeable when switching between contrasting flavors like:

  • Tobacco → Fruity
  • Menthol → Dessert
  • Coffee → Fruit

 Step-by-Step: How to Get Rid of Ghost Flavors Completely

Here’s a full guide to eliminate every trace of old flavors and enjoy your new juice as intended:

1. Disassemble the Tank Completely

Take your device apart into its core components:

  • Drip tip
  • Tank glass
  • Tank base
  • Top cap
  • Coil (remove but don’t clean if it’s a stock coil)

Check for any sticky spots or discoloration, especially in the crevices and threads.

2. Soak in High-Proof Alcohol or Vodka

For deep flavor removal, alcohol is the most effective solvent:

  • Fill a bowl with unflavored high-proof vodka or isopropyl alcohol (at least 90%).
  • Place all non-electronic, non-coil parts of your tank in the alcohol.
  • Let soak for 30 minutes to 1 hour.

This breaks down:

  • Sweeteners
  • Flavoring oils
  • PG/VG buildup

3. Scrub with a Soft Brush or Cotton Swab

After soaking, scrub:

  • Inside the chimney (the narrow tube where vapor travels)
  • Around the O-rings
  • Under the base threads

Use:

  • A cotton swab for tight spaces
  • A soft toothbrush for glass and metal parts

This physical removal is key to fully clearing out flavor particles.

4. Rinse Everything with Warm Water

cleaning vape

Even after alcohol cleaning, rinse with warm water to remove any remaining residue and alcohol traces.

Optional Tip: Use a few drops of mild dish soap with warm water if the flavor was particularly strong (e.g., menthol, cinnamon, coffee). Rinse thoroughly afterward.

5. Dry Thoroughly (No Moisture Left!)

Lay all parts on a paper towel or microfiber cloth. Let them air dry for at least an hour or use a blow dryer on low heat to speed it up.

Water trapped inside the tank can dilute your juice or damage the coil.

6. Replace the Coil (Very Important!)

If you’re using a prebuilt stock coil, it’s almost impossible to remove ghost flavors from the cotton inside. Always:

  • Install a new coil when switching flavors or after a ghosting issue.
  • If using a rebuildable coil, remove old wick, dry burn the coil (pulse it gently), and re-wick with fresh cotton.

Warning: Washing a stock coil doesn’t remove ghost flavors—it usually just kills the coil

7. Don’t Forget the Drip Tip

Your mouthpiece can carry a surprising amount of residual flavor and bacteria. Soak it in warm soapy water or alcohol, scrub it inside and out, then rinse and dry it thoroughly.

8. Reassemble and Prime Coil

After everything is dry:

  • Reassemble your tank.
  • Add a few drops of e-liquid to the cotton if using a new coil (priming).
  • Fill your tank and wait 5-10 minutes before vaping.

This allows the coil to saturate evenly and ensures you don’t get a dry hit.

Cleaning Vape Tank with Water – Is It Enough?

Cleaning Vape Tank with Water – Is It Enough?

Water alone is suitable for regular quick cleans, especially if you’re not switching flavors. However, for sweet or strong e-liquids, you’ll need something stronger like alcohol.

Cleaning AgentBest Use CaseNotes
Warm WaterLight residue, same flavorEasy, quick, but limited
Mild Dish SoapSlight buildup, fruity juicesRinse well afterward
Vodka/AlcoholHeavy residue, flavor changeBest for deep cleaning

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Can I clean my vape tank every day?

You can, but it’s typically not necessary unless you switch flavors daily or use very sweet e-liquids.

What’s the best way to clean sticky residue?

A soak in unflavored vodka or isopropyl alcohol followed by a warm rinse.

Can I boil my vape tank to clean it?

Boiling is not recommended, as it may damage rubber or plastic components.

Do I need to clean a brand-new tank?

Yes. Even new tanks can contain manufacturing oils or dust.
